Conjecture on maximizers of the partition discrepancy

For partitions β\beta and u u, let βν\beta\sqcup\nu denote the partition obtained by distributing the parts of β\beta and u u among the parts of a partition λˉ\bar\lambda of nn, and let Δ(λ,μ,ν)\Delta(\lambda,\mu,\nu) be the quantity defined in the source. The maximum of Δ(λ,μ,ν)\Delta(\lambda,\mu,\nu) over triples with λn\lambda\vdash n, μnk\mu\vdash n-k, and νk\nu\vdash k is attained at a triple of partitions satisfying the following condition.

Maximizer conjecture. At most one part of λ\lambda is the sum of a part in μ\mu and a part in ν\nu, while the other parts of λ\lambda are distributed in μ\mu and ν\nu.

This conjecture proposes a structural description of a maximizer for the discrepancy Δ\Delta; the supplied text gives no resolution, so its status remains open.
